Civic House Multi-fuction Community Space

Awarded Silver for Architecture: Retrofit at The Scottish Design Awards

Civic House is a thriving community space in Glasgow that hosts a dynamic range of activities – coworking, festivals, workshops, talks and food events (to name a few!).

Funded by the Climate Challenge Fund and Scottish Power Energy Network’s (SPEN) Green Economic Fund, Collective Architecture was commissioned by Agile City to undertake the refurbishment and thermal upgrade of this early 20th century industrial warehouse located in the north of Glasgow. Civic House started life as Civic Press in the 1920s and was a derilict building with immense heating costs.

The core principle of the project was to create a leading example that demonstrated carbon reduction innovation as Scotland’s first retrofit ‘PassivWareHaus’. As part of the ‘whole systems approach’, the refurbishment of Civic House included:

  • – External Wall Insulation
  • – High performance doors and windows
  • – Mechanical Ventilation Heat Recovery System (MVHR)
  • – Air Source Heat Pump
  • – Composite Insulated roof panel system
  • – Photovoltaics Panels – roof array 50kWp

Now complete, the project aims to deliver a public learning programme that explores sustainability and inclusive city development to increase knowledge, develop new skills and drive local behavioural change. As a community-based workspace, the project aims to demonstrate that small actions can generate large-scale impact.

PAUL Heat Recovery has been working closely with Rupert Daly of Collective Architecture and Rob of Agyle City to explore the ventilation requirements of the building and come up with an innovative MVHR design, incorporating two Zehnder ComfoAir 600 MVHR systems, cascade ventilation and fan to optimise the air flow through the large two-storey community spaces and the adjacent offices and facilities.
